Cave Dwellers was a European film that was made in 1984. The movie was written and directed by Joe D'Amato. The filming for this movie was done in Italy. It starred Miles O'Keeffe as Ator, a man skilled in not only fighting, but in many other arts as well. It also starred Charles Borromel as Akronas, a wise ruler and teacher who is also called the Great One. Lisa Foster starred as Mila, the daughter of Akronas, and David Brandon starred as Zor - the principal villan in this film. The movie was made as a copy of the Conan movies which starred Arnold Schwarzenegger.
The movie was featured in an episode of Mystery Science Theater 3000. It is one of the more popular episodes of the series.

Akronas has discovered the Geometric Nucleus during the course of his research. The nucleus is a device of incredible power that could be a terrible weapon. Akronas feels that the nucleus must be kept from evil men at all costs. When he learns that Zor and his army are approaching his castle, he asks his daughter Mila to bring his former student Ator back to help defeat Zor. Mila runs away to find Ator. Zor's soliders enter and begin beating Akronas, but Zor angrily sends them away to maintain the image of a man who would only use violence if needed.
Mila is prusued by Zor's soliders. One of the soliders eventually shoots her with an arrow that hits her near the shoulder. She continues to stagger towards Ator's home. Meanwhile, Ator is working on his swords, putting suggestions that his Asian assistant Thong (Chen Wong) about the sword to good use. He also tries new strength routines suggested by Thong, and finds them very useful. Suddenly Mila runs in with the arrow still imbedded in her body. At this point, Ator uses his medical knowledge to remove the arrow from Mila's body. She then is able to convince him she is the daughter of Akronas, and that her father is in terrible danger.
Mila, Ator, and Thong make their way back to Akronas' castle. They face a variety of dangers, including a group of cannibals, another group determined to sacrifice them to their god - which is a huge snake, and other soliders.
Finally they make it back to the castle. Ator tells Mila and Thong to sneak in the back way. Ator uses his knowledge of fight to make a hang glider, which he flies over the castle. He also drops bombs on Zor's soliders. With most of Zor's forces either dead or gone, Ator goes to the chamber of Akronas. There he engages in combat with Zor. Ator is able to defeat Zor, and Akronas convinces Ator to let Zor live to face trial. When Ator steps away, Zor grabs a sword to threaten Ator, and Zor is killed by Thong.
Afterwards, Akronas gives the Geometric Nucleus to Ator. Ator tells Mila he has to leave, that his life is too dangerous to share with her. Mila says that she knows Ator must fight evil where ever it occurs. Ator leaves Thong behind to help take care of Mila and Akronas, and leaves. He takes the nucleus to a distant land, and detonates it in a huge explosion.
